A behavioral therapist focuses on the antecedents and consequences associated with a behavior. Functional Analysis is the therapist utilizing.
- Therapists, often known as psychotherapists, are qualified mental health professionals who focus on assisting their patients in enhancing their cognitive and emotional abilities, minimizing the signs of mental disease, and managing a variety of life issues.
- A complex set of interpersonal abilities, such as verbal fluency, interpersonal perception, affective modulation and expression, warmth and acceptance, and empathy, are possessed by effective therapists. Effective therapists help their patients feel understood, trusted, and hopeful that they can get well.
- Goals for therapy include altering behaviors, creating and maintaining relationships, improving coping skills, and facilitating growth and development.
- By mimicking the client's verbal and physical language, therapists can demonstrate their empathy for their patient.
